Dividend Growth Investing: A Beginner's Guide

Dividend payouts investing, specifically the growth variety, is a plan for building a consistent income stream. For novices, it concentrates on purchasing stock in companies that consistently raise their dividend remittances over time . This approach isn't about pursuing the highest present dividend percentage ; instead, it’s about finding companies with a track record of dividend enhancements and the possibility for upcoming growth .

The Power of Compounding: A Dividend Growth Plan

Achieving substantial wealth returns often copyrights on harnessing the potent force of compounding, particularly when utilized within a dividend growth system. Essentially this involves purchasing companies that regularly boost their dividend distributions over years. This creates a positive cycle: initial dividend revenue are reinvested to purchase more shares of the identical company, leading to ever-increasing dividend returns. With time , this seemingly small incremental increase in distributions can snowball into a considerable sum . Consider the impact on your investments when dividends not only grow but also create more payouts – it's a powerful mechanism for establishing long-term wealth security.

Dividend Growth Investing vs. Value Investing: Which is Right for You?

Choosing between a investment – dividend growth investing or pursuing undervalued stocks – can be the puzzle for aspiring investors. Dividend growth investing involves buying stocks of firms with demonstrated history of regularly raising their returns, hoping long-term returns as those dividends escalate. In contrast, value investing identifies firms that look discounted by the, often due to short-term problems, hoping that market will ultimately recognize this incorrect assessment. Which method suits you relies on your risk tolerance and time horizon.
